World Tourism Day 2024: Rwanda Ambassador Discovers Rwanda At La Campagne Tropicana Beach Resort

It was World Tourism Day and the celebration was loud at La Campagne Tropicana Beach Resort where the Ambassador of Rwanda in Nigeria,  Christophe Bazivamo was visiting, as part of the activities lined up to commemorate the day, September 27th.

It was also an opportunity for Ambassador Christophe Bazivamo to take time out, to inspect the foremost African beach resort, which has been pencilled down, as the proposed venue, for the upcoming IPADA Carnival celebration slated for November 29th to December 8th 2024.

The drum beat crescendo for the IPADA Carnival is almost at its peak, with concerted efforts to ensure the success of the carnival, by incorporating diplomats from different African countries and in the Diaspora into the larger framework.

The excitement was real at the arrival of Ambassador Christophe Bazivamo to La Campagne Tropicana Beach Resort, the African themed resort, located at Ibeju-lekki, Lagos, Nigeria.
